Backfilling services involve the process of filling in excavated areas around foundations, trenches, or other structures to restore stability and support. This work typically follows construction, repairs, or excavation projects, ensuring that the soil is properly compacted to prevent future settling or shifting. Skilled service providers use specialized equipment and techniques to ensure that backfill material is evenly distributed and securely packed, helping to maintain the integrity of the property’s structural elements.
This service addresses common problems such as soil erosion, foundation instability, and uneven settling that can occur after excavation or construction activities. Improper backfilling can lead to cracks in walls, uneven floors, or even more severe structural issues over time. By ensuring proper backfill procedures, property owners can reduce the risk of costly repairs and maintain the safety and durability of their structures.

The overview below groups typical Backfilling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Evans, CO.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Labor Costs - Backfilling services typically range from $50 to $150 per hour, depending on the project's complexity and local rates. For example, a small residential backfill might cost around $200, while larger projects could reach $1,000 or more.
Material Expenses - The cost of materials such as soil, gravel, or fill dirt generally varies between $10 and $50 per cubic yard. For instance, a typical backyard backfill project might require 5 cubic yards, costing approximately $50 to $250 in materials.
Equipment Fees - Equipment rental fees for backfilling services often fall between $100 and $300 per day. Heavy machinery like excavators or loaders may be needed, with rental costs depending on the duration and type of equipment used.
Additional Charges - Extra costs may include site preparation, hauling away debris, or permits, which can add $100 to $500 or more to the overall expense. These charges vary based on project scope and local regulations.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
